Key Trends Shaping the Online Gambling Industry

The online gambling sector is influenced by several dynamic trends that continue to redefine player experiences and operator strategies. Understanding these trends is essential for stakeholders aiming to stay competitive.

  • Mobile Gaming Dominance: With smartphones becoming ubiquitous, mobile gambling apps have surged in popularity, offering convenience and accessibility.
  • Live Dealer Games: The integration of live streaming technology has brought authentic casino experiences to players’ screens, enhancing engagement.
  • Cryptocurrency Payments: The adoption of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in offers faster, more secure transactions and appeals to privacy-conscious users.
  • Regulatory Evolution: Governments worldwide are updating laws to better regulate online gambling, impacting market entry and compliance requirements.
  • Artificial Intelligence and Personalization: AI-driven algorithms tailor gaming experiences, promotions, and customer support to individual preferences.

Challenges Facing Online Gambling Operators

Despite the promising growth, the industry faces several hurdles that operators must navigate carefully.

  • Regulatory Compliance: Navigating complex and varying regulations across jurisdictions can be costly and time-consuming.
  • Security Concerns: Protecting user data and preventing fraud remain top priorities amid increasing cyber threats.
  • Market Saturation: Intense competition requires innovative marketing and unique offerings to attract and retain players.
  • Responsible Gambling Enforcement: Operators must implement effective measures to identify and assist problem gamblers.

Comparing Popular Online Gambling Markets

The global online gambling market varies significantly by region, influenced by cultural attitudes, legal frameworks, and technological infrastructure. The table below compares some of the most prominent markets:

Comparison of Leading Online Gambling Markets (2024)
Region Market Size (USD Billion) Regulatory Environment Popular Game Types Growth Rate (CAGR)
Europe 35.2 Strict but well-established Sports betting, Poker, Slots 7.5%
North America 28.9 Rapidly evolving Sports betting, Casino games 12.3%
Asia-Pacific 22.4 Varied, often restrictive Lottery, Slots, Sports betting 9.8%
Latin America 8.7 Emerging regulations Sports betting, Casino 11.0%
